This formidable foe is more than the original Avengers can handle, as they seek the assistance of two enemies turned allies to save the world from destruction. When Tony Stark and Bruce Banner explore the power within the glowing jewel stored inside, they unintentionally create Ultron, an evil robot who sees humanity as a genetic mistake that he must correct. The Avengers assemble again to take down the last of Hydra’s bases where they discover Loki’s scepter. The follow-up to the record-breaking Marvel’s The Avengers, aka the highest grossing film of 2012, hit theaters in May and nearly matched its predecessor’s worldwide box office haul despite competition from this summer’s juggernaut, Jurassic World. ![]() ![]() Fans who have already leaped into the disc-less future or who simply couldn’t wait another month can now enjoy one of the best films of 2015 in the comfort of their home, as well as anywhere they go. In case you’re looking for it in stores right now, it doesn’t get released on Blu-Ray, DVD or standard definition digital until October 2 nd. For proof that Hollywood wants you to buy your movies digitally in HD instead of on discs, see Avengers: Age of Ultron, which was released on Digital HD on September 8 th. ![]()
